Biography - Joe Greenwell
Joe Greenwell was appointed to the role of Chairman, Ford of
Britain, on 1 January 2009.
Joe Greenwell is also the 2009 president of the UK automotive
industry's trade organisation, the Society of Motor Manufacturers
and Traders and he is President of BEN, the Motor and Allied Trades
Benevolent Fund.
Prior to his appointment to these positions, Joe Greenwell was
Vice President, Government Affairs, Premier Automotive Group and
Ford of Europe, from 1 September 2005.
Greenwell's responsibilities included helping to develop and
co-ordinate Ford Motor Company's strategy with Government and other
official bodies in the European region.
Prior to this position, Joe Greenwell was Chairman and CEO of
Jaguar and Land Rover where he was responsible for overseeing sales
and production expansion at Land Rover and setting in train
necessary structural changes at Jaguar.
Previously, he had been Vice President, Marketing and
Operations, since August 2002. In that role, he was responsible for
Ford of Canada, Ford of Mexico, Worldwide Direct Market Operations
and Global Marketing.
Prior to that, Joe Greenwell had been Vice President,
Communications and Public Affairs, Ford of Europe and had performed
the same role at Jaguar Cars.
